中国距水虻属四新种(双翅目,水虻科)

李竹、张婷婷、杨定2011-01-01Acta Scientiarum Naturalium Universitatis Sunyatseni

记述我国距水虻属Allognosta 4新种,基黑距水虻A.basinigra sp.nov.,彩旗距水虻A.caiqiana sp.nov.,大龙潭距水虻A.dalongtana sp.nov.,梁氏距水虻A.liangi sp.nov.。模式标本保存在中国农业大学昆虫博物馆。

热处理对等离子喷涂Al 2 O 3 -13%TiO 2 涂层结合强度的影响

袁鸿斌、王泽华、张晶晶 等 7 位作者2011-01-01机械工程材料

在Q235钢基体上等离子喷涂NiCrAl粘结层和Al2O3-13%TiO2工作层, 并在300~900 ℃对涂层进行大气、真空及氩气环境下的热处理, 借助OM、SEM、XRD以及电子万能试验机等研究了加热温度、保温时间以及热处理气氛对涂层显微结构和结合强度的影响。结果表明: 气氛对涂层结合强度的影响较小, 保温时间的影响较大, 加热温度的影响最显著; 适当的热处理可以减小微裂纹尺寸, 提高涂层的结合强度; 经500 ℃保温6 h真空热处理的涂层与原始涂层相比, 可以使其结合强度提高62.5%, 达到31.2 MPa。

压痕—淬冷法研究LaPO 4 -ZrO 2 复合陶瓷的抗热震性能

赵英娜、李中秋、郝瑞华 等 4 位作者2011-01-01稀有金属材料与工程

用压痕-淬冷法测定不同LaPO4含量的LaPO4-ZrO2复合陶瓷的抗热震性能,通过扫描电镜观察不同温度热震后的裂纹扩展形态。结果表明,1550℃烧结的复合陶瓷中LaPO4含量为20vol%时,临界热震温差约为400℃,比纯氧化锆陶瓷约高出150℃。弱界面的数量和尺寸对复合陶瓷的热震性有着重要的影响。适当尺寸弱界面以及LaPO4颗粒的存在使裂纹扩展阻力增大,热震裂纹在弱界面处的偏转及分叉耗散了主裂纹扩展能,从而改善了复合材料的热震性能。
